## Thumbnail Queue: Plugin Onboarding

Pixelforge plugins enqueue thumbnail jobs via the Renderline queue, not directly against storage. Register your plugin handle first, then push jobs with source key, target sizes, and a priority flag. Jobs over 20MB are deferred to the batch lane. Retries: three attempts, exponential backoff. Do not poll faster than once per second; use the completion webhook instead. Failed jobs land in the dead-letter table for 72 hours. To inspect queue state locally, connect using the string below.

primary connection of yagep-kahip = redis://giliel_svc:zYiKsLL2PLpfPL@db-348f.xolmarsys.corp:5432/fenwyn

Handover note — to receiving, Drellgate workshop

Shipping the Aldercott mantel clock today for escapement repair. Crated in foam, movement locked, pendulum packed separately in the small box taped inside the lid. Keep upright; the case veneer is fragile. Repair order is in the document sleeve. Don't uncrate until Merritt's bench is clear. Inspect the crate for transit damage on arrival and note anything before signing. Courier hand-over instruction is below.

drop instructions, yafog-yawip: the quenmir olidor courier leaves the julox tamion keliel ledger at gate 5283 under passcode 336825

Subject: SQL lint cut-over complete

Hi, and welcome aboard. Last night we finished migrating the Coppervale repositories to the new SQL linting rules. All .sql files now pass the Quenchly linter in CI; the old advisory-only stage has been removed, so lint failures block merges. We normalized keyword casing, banned implicit joins, and enforced explicit column lists in inserts. Please run the linter locally before pushing — it catches most issues in seconds. The linter reads the settings shown below.

service settings:
WENATH_PIN=5007
WENATH_METRICS_HOST=metrics.wenath.tolvaqlabs.corp
WENATH_LOG_LEVEL=debug
WENATH_TENANT=rusox

**Leadership Review Briefing – Regional Sales**

For sales leads. Corvane region exceeded target by 6%; Ashbrook flat; Telmere down 4% on delayed contract signings with Pellward Group. Pipeline coverage stands at 2.1x for Q4. Territory realignment proposals due before the review. One confidential point follows for attendees only.

internal memo for kaduf-baduf: Only 35 of the 378 pilot accounts renewed Holir, so a churn review is set for June 11. Eliielax Group is in early talks to buy Silaelix Group for about $142.1 million.